云原生弹性扩容:架构驱动高效测试
|
在云原生环境下,功能测试工程师需要更加关注系统的弹性和可扩展性。传统的测试方法往往难以应对动态变化的资源需求,而云原生架构则提供了自动化的弹性扩容能力,这为测试工作带来了新的挑战和机遇。 弹性扩容的核心在于根据负载情况自动调整计算资源,这要求我们在设计测试用例时考虑不同规模下的系统行为。功能测试不仅要验证核心业务逻辑,还需要评估系统在高负载或突发流量下的稳定性与响应能力。 作为功能测试工程师,我们应深入理解云原生架构中的服务编排、容器化部署以及自动伸缩策略。这些技术细节直接影响测试场景的设计和执行,例如如何模拟真实的流量波动,如何监控资源使用情况,以及如何评估扩容后的系统表现。 测试过程中,我们需要结合自动化工具和监控平台,实时获取系统性能指标,并将这些数据作为测试结果的一部分进行分析。这种数据驱动的测试方式能够更准确地反映系统在弹性扩容后的实际表现。 测试团队应与开发和运维团队保持紧密协作,确保测试环境与生产环境的一致性。通过共享测试数据和反馈机制,可以更快地发现并修复潜在问题,提升整体系统的可靠性。
AI生成内容图,仅供参考 云原生弹性扩容不仅提升了系统的可用性,也对测试流程提出了更高的要求。功能测试工程师需要不断学习新技术,优化测试策略,以适应快速变化的云环境。 最终,架构驱动的高效测试不仅是技术上的突破,更是测试理念的转变。只有将测试深度融入架构设计中,才能真正实现高质量的云原生应用。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

